4.1 Traditional French Doors
Traditional French doors are identified by their traditional style, featuring numerous small glass panes divided by a grid pattern referred to as "muntins." They are normally made from wood and can be tailored with numerous surfaces, offering a captivating look suited for vintage or classic home styles.
4.2 Sliding French Doors
Sliding French doors function by moving along a track instead of swinging open. This style is ideal for smaller areas where standard hinges might impede movement. They often include big glass panels, optimizing natural light intake in addition to offering expansive outdoor views.
4.3 Bi-Fold French Doors
Bi-fold French doors include numerous panels that fold and slide against each other, developing a wide opening suited for outdoor patios and garden spaces. This style is exceptionally popular for modern homes, efficiently combining indoor and outdoor living locations.
4.4 Single French Doors
Single French doors include a single panel and are ideal for smaller entryways, like a research study or a nook. While they maintain the beauty of conventional French doors, they require less space and can fit different architectural styles.

Maintenance Tips
To make sure the durability and efficiency of French doors, property owners ought to adhere to the following upkeep pointers:
Regular Cleaning: Wipe down the glass and frames to keep clarity and appearance.Look for Damage: Inspect for any indications of wear, rot, or damage, especially in wood doors.Lubricate Hinges: Keep hinges properly lubed to ensure smooth operation.Weather Stripping: Check and replace weather stripping if it's worn to preserve energy efficiency.8.
